A bright apartment in De Buitenpepers

This apartment on Buitenpepersdreef 143 sits in De Buitenpepers, a lively part of Den Bosch. The home is a gallery flat on the second floor, built in 1973, and it offers a bright, open feel with a free view. The asking price of €482,500 is on the high side compared to other [apartments in Den Bosch], which average around €406,333.

Inside the home

The apartment has four rooms, including three bedrooms and one bathroom, spread over a single floor. The living area is 118 m² according to the BAG registration, while the agent lists it as 121 m². It comes with a balcony and a garage box, and the whole is heated by block heating. The home has double glazing and is offered as full ownership, with a monthly HOA fee of €347.40.

Life in De Buitenpepers

Residents of the district give their living environment an average score of 7.31, based on seven reviews. One resident says: "Very cosy neighbourhood, very social and everyone takes care of each other when needed." Another notes: "I've lived there since 2017 and I enjoy living there, no problems." The neighbourhood counts about 2,185 inhabitants, with a mix of ages and household types. For more on the area, see [the De Buitenpepers neighbourhood].

Amenities and transport

For daily errands, a PLUS supermarket is just around the corner, and an Albert Heijn is a ten-minute walk away. The nearest primary school, KC Het IJzeren Kind, is a couple of streets away, and there are several others within a short distance. A GP practice and a pharmacy are both just around the corner. Public transport is well within reach: a bus stop at Bruistensingel is on your doorstep with lines 4 and 665, and the train station 's-Hertogenbosch Oost is a five-minute walk. The wider surroundings are served by [the municipality of Den Bosch].

WOZ and address data

The WOZ value is €436,000, based on the reference date 1 January 2025. The asking price is 11% above this value. Over the past five years, the WOZ value has developed in line with the local market. According to area-level risk data, the foundation risk indication is low. Road traffic noise is measured at 58 dB Lden, which is above the norm, while railway noise is 46 dB Lden, below the norm. Pluvial flooding risk is low, but the current flood risk is elevated, and by 2050 it is expected to be medium. These are indications at area level, not an inspection of this specific home.
